试看是指用户在观看音视频时,只能观看指定时长的内容。适用在付费、会员等场景。
通常有以下几种试看方案:
单独剪辑一个固定时长的视频文件。
优点:安全性高,有效防止播放连接泄露,用户试看时只能拿到试看视频的播放地址,无法获取原始视频播放地址,实现简单,可分发。
缺点:不能灵活支持不同的试看时长
服务端支持试看。
优点:安全可靠。
缺点:需基于CDN能力支持试看。各厂家支持的格式不同,场景单一,无法灵活的支持多种格式的试看场景。
在播放器端适配试看时长。
优点:实现简单,配置方便。
缺点:无法防止恶意用户抓取完整播放连接盗播。
本文介绍一种基于播放器端控制播放时长,并结合 视频点播 防盗链的 解决方案 ,做到灵活支持试看时长,配置方便,安全可靠。
步骤1、在视频点播平台配置防盗链,防盗链过期时间可设置成5-10min(根据试看时长设置)
步骤2、生成带防盗链播放地址,在播放器设置试看时长,并且通过防盗链阻止用户抓取连接恶意盗播。
备注:可独立配置一个试看 域名 ,配置防盗链时长。再配置一个正常播放的域名,在用户付费后,提供该域名对应的播放地址。
// 本文以播放器demo为例介绍试看简单实现。video_play播放地址src修改成实际可播放地址
// 若需实现更精准的试看,可通过播放地址响应的错误码,及时更新防盗链秘钥信息。
您的试看已结束!
版权声明:本文章文字内容来自第三方投稿,版权归原始作者所有。本网站不拥有其版权,也不承担文字内容、信息或资料带来的版权归属问题或争议。如有侵权,请联系contentedit@huawei.com,本网站有权在核实确属侵权后,予以删除文章。